West Nipissing…where are you?

When we first launched WestNipissingOuest.com in August of this year, we had a vision of creating an online community hub where people, from all walks, could share, collaborate, vent, discuss, learn, debate, and every other action verb one would associate with a vibrant and active online community. We built the site with custom scripts that would allow anyone from West Nipissing to quickly and easily contribute news, events, tips, photos, articles, editorials, columns and everything in between.

For too long, we’ve had no public forum or central online presence where our voices could be heard. Traditional media can’t, and never has, filled that need. The operative word being “need”. How can community exist when it’s heart is complacent and it’s members live out their  lives in relative isolation?

Driving down our streets, walking the sidewalks or store aisles, I don’t recognize half of the people I see. “Who is that?”, I ask. “What does he or she do?”. “What’s their story?”. When someone sets up a new business, it can be months before I find out. And what about all you volunteers, artists, musicians, hobbyists, writers, home based business people? I know you’re out there…but where?

Perhaps I’m naive, but I believe everyone has a story. Everyone has a particular skill or expertise. Everyone has an opinion. So why aren’t we sharing? Has it dawned on you that you’re not alone? That others, such as myself, might be interested to learn about you? Do you work in the financial sector and have some tips to share? Construction? Retail? Do you have a big family reunion coming up? Are you an artist, writer or musician looking to share some of your work?

Well? What are you waiting for? We’re here West Nipissing! Where are you?
